Types of Timber Products Offered by Bulk Suppliers
Bulk timber suppliers usually offer a range of timber products tailored to different requirements. Below are some common types:
Hardwoods
Hardwoods, known for their strength and durability, are popular for high-end furniture and flooring. Common hardwood species include:
- Oak: A favorite for its toughness and beautiful grain.
- Maple: Prized for its light color and fine grain, perfect for modern furniture.
- Cherry: Acclaimed for its rich color and smooth finish.
Softwoods
Softwoods are often used in construction and are lighter than hardwoods. Some common softwoods are:
- Pine: Versatile and affordable, a common choice for framing.
- Spruce: Reliable for structural applications due to its strength-to-weight ratio.
- Cedar: Naturally resistant to decay, ideal for outdoor projects.
Engineered Wood Products
Engineered wood products offer added dimensional stability and can be produced from various wood sources, including:
- Plywood: Laminated sheets used widely in construction and DIY projects.
- OSB (Oriented Strand Board): An alternative to plywood, often used for sheathing and flooring.
- LVL (Laminated Veneer Lumber): Used for beams and headers, providing high strength levels.

Sustainability in Timber Supply
As the world becomes more environmentally conscious, the integrity of sourcing sustainable timber is paramount. It is vital for bulk timber suppliers to promote sustainable practices, including:
- Ensuring that timber comes from responsibly managed forests.
- Obtaining certifications such as FSC (Forest Stewardship Council) and PEFC (Programme for the Endorsement of Forest Certification).
- Implementing processes that minimize waste and promote recycling of timber products.
By choosing a supplier that prioritizes sustainability, businesses can enhance their brand image while contributing positively to the environment.
